DECK FEATURES

Cards:

  • Rider-Waite Structure that includes 80 cards (24 Major Arcana cards and 56 Minor Arcana cards) (Fully illustrated)
  • Standard Tarot Size (2.75 x 4.75 inches = 7 x 12 cm)
  • 330 GSM GERMAN BLACKCORE CARDSTOCK with linen finish
  • Gilded edges

Booklet:

  • The deck comes with a 100-page physical Little White Booklet (LWB) measuring 2.75 x 4.75 inches (7 x 12 cm)) that includes insights for every card (keywords and meanings for upright and reversed draws).

Box:

  • The cards and booklet come in a beautiful magnetic enclosure box!

DECK STORY

When I went to Italy last year, I didn’t expect to come back changed. Standing among the ruins and temples, I felt pulled into the world of Greek and Roman myths. 

Back home, that spark grew into a full-blown obsession. I couldn’t stop reading about the gods, the heroes, the strange and beautiful stories. And the more I read, the more I saw how they lined up with tarot: Persephone’s descent and return was Death, the card of endings that lead to rebirth. Apollo’s Pythia at Delphi was The High Priestess, the voice of hidden wisdom. Hephaestus at his forge was The Magician, turning raw material into vision.

I loved Rome so much that I even went back for my honeymoon. There’s something about walking through those streets, seeing layers of history all around you, that makes the myths feel alive again.

As someone on the spectrum, I often fall deep into the things I love. That focus became the heart of this project. I started imagining how these myths could live again through tarot, how the archetypes in the cards and the figures in the stories could mirror one another.
